What companies run services between Tomorrowland, Belgium and Lyon, France?
TGV inOui operates a train from Brussel-Zuid / Bruxelles-Midi to Lyon Part Dieu every 4 hours. Tickets cost €120–200 and the journey takes 3h 55m. Alternatively, BlaBlaCar Bus operates a bus from Antwerp - Rooseveltplaats to Lyon - Perrache Bus Station 4 times a week. Tickets cost €50–70 and the journey takes 10h 40m.
